What Happens After a Referral?
- Initial Contact: We connect with the participant and family to explain the process and gather information about their goals, preferences, and needs.
- Assessment & Planning: We conduct an informal, person-centred assessment to understand the individual, then develop an Interim or Comprehensive Behaviour Support Plan as needed.
- Implementation & Training: We work with the participant’s support network to implement strategies effectively, providing guidance, coaching, and practical tools.
- Ongoing Review: We continue to monitor progress, adjust strategies, and provide updates to ensure the support remains effective and responsive.
